Betula utilis var. jacquemontii 'Grayswood Ghost' (AGM) 12L

Product Code: 193633
£89.99
  • Common Name: Himalayan Birch
  • This variety has beautiful clean white bark peeling to reveal orange tints. Excellent golden tones in autumn.
  • Foliage: Deciduous. Habit: Columnar upright
  • Position: Full sun, Partial shade. Aspect: South-facing or West-facing or East-facing or North-facing.
  • Soil: Loam, Sand, Clay, Chalk. Moisture: Moist but well-drained, Well-drained. pH: Acid, Alkaline, Neutral
  • Ultimate height: Higher than 12 metres. Ultimate spread: 4-8 metres. Time to ultimate height: 20-50 years
  • Suggested planting locations: Architectural, City and courtyard gardens, Low maintenance
